How can we be sure that God's Word is true?

Answered in 1 source

God's Word is true because it is divinely inspired and supported by the consistent testimony of scripture.

The truth of God's Word is established in 2 Peter 1:20-21, which asserts that no prophecy is of private interpretation, and that all scripture is given by the inspiration of God. Holy men wrote the scriptures as they were moved by the Holy Spirit, ensuring that God's message remains pure and infallible. Furthermore, when believers read and understand scripture, they encounter a perfect and consistent revelation of God's character and His plan for salvation, reinforcing the reliability and truth of the Bible as the ultimate authority.
Scripture References: 2 Peter 1:20-21, 2 Timothy 3:16
